- Title
Virological and immunological response in HIV-1-infected patients with multiple treatment failures receiving raltegravir and optimized background therapy, ANRS CO3 Aquitaine Cohort.
- Authors
Wittkop, Linda; Breilh, Dominique; Da Silva, Daniel; Duffau, Pierre; Mercié, Patrick; Raymond, Isabelle; Anies, Guerric; Fleury, Hervé; Saux, Marie-Claude; Dabis, Francois; Fagard, Catherine; Thiébaut, Rodolphe; Masquelier, Bernard; Pellegrin, Isabelle; ANRS CO3 Aquitaine Cohort
- Abstract
The efficacy of raltegravir plus optimized background therapy (OBT) has been demonstrated for antiretroviral (ARV)-experienced HIV-1-infected patients in randomized clinical trials. We studied viro-immunological response, pharmacokinetic parameters and genotypic test results in an observational cohort of multiple ARV class-experienced patients starting a raltegravir-based regimen.
